Experience digital news differently. Beautifully designed and easy to navigate on mobile and tablet, the Guardian Editions brings you the stories that matter every morning.

- A new way to read: the UK newspaper, for mobile and tablet
- Updated daily: each UK edition is available to read by 6am (GMT), 7 days a week
- Multiple devices: beautifully designed for your iPhone and iPad
- Read offline: schedule a download and read whenever it suits you

Gorgeous, great for offline, but missing sections

I finished the 81 day free trial two months ago, and still come back to this app almost every day. It's perfect for the subway, because there's no need for an active internet connection.

Nonetheless, this is a smaller edited version of the print or online version. While the interface and portability are great, I've occasionally been on Facebook or Twitter and seen a friend post a great article from the guardian from sometime in the last week, only to find that although I had read all 6 iPad editions that week, had not seen the article.

While I was visiting London I bought the paper edition a few times to compare that day's content and the iPad content. The images and text flow much better in the paper edition, and with the online edition the comments are always entertaining. The in-app browser function could be improved too.

Nicest: paper edition
Fullest: online edition
Most portable: iPad edition

Why can’t you leave a good thing alone?

The latest update to news print style presentation on mobile phones and iPads is a disaster. The whole point of hyperlinks is that you choose what you want. With the newsprint text on a cell phone or small tablet so small, one only has the headlines to decide whether to read the article in full. Can you give the reader a choice of newspaper or article format? Sure, some people like reading old style, but a lot of people just don’t have the eyes for it. Newspaper style simply doesn’t work on small devices.
